One of the arguments for using hydrogenated oils is that they don't get rancid (bacterial reduction is inhibited which would otherwise be leading to free radicals and further oxidation.) That's gotta make you wonder: if the bacteria can eat it, should we?

Ever smell oil that has a "dusty" odor? That the beginning of the rancidity process. Rancid oils should be avoided.
